Michelle Clunie Is an American actress, best known for her roles on Queer as Folk and Make It or Break It. On House, M.D., she portrayed Judy, the imaginary wife of Vince in the Season 3 episode No Reason.
Clunie has also had featured roles in Lost & Found, The Jeff Foxworth Show and Jason Goes to Hell: The Final Friday.
